Portland cement clinker taking tungsten tailings as raw material and preparation method of Portland cement clinker
The invention discloses Portland cement clinker taking tungsten tailings as a raw material and a preparation method of the Portland cement clinker, and belongs to the technical field of cement clinker. The Portland cement clinker comprises the following components in parts by weight: 0.5-40 parts of tungsten tailings, 60-95 parts of limestone, 0-20 parts of a siliceous material and 0-20 parts of an iron raw material, the influence of an agent can be eliminated through a high-temperature calcination environment, a large amount of tungsten tailings can be directly consumed, meanwhile, the iron material, the siliceous material and the limestone in Portland cement ingredients can be replaced, the cost is reduced, and the economic benefit is increased. Part of tungsten tailings contain fluorite and rare metals, so that the burnability of the cement raw material can be effectively improved, the energy consumption is reduced, and the economic value is very high.
